Объясните, что такое платформа GitLab и как она используется в процессе разработки программного обеспечения.
В каких ситуациях происходит рост стека при выполнении программы?
Как бы ты поступил, если бы получил предложения о работе от нескольких работодателей одновременно?
Можешь привести пример драйверов, которые ты писал или использовал в проектах?
Можете объяснить различия между типами данных по значению и по ссылке?
Может ли объяснить, что такое постоянное значение в программировании?
Что отличает интерфейсы IEnumerable и IQueryable в использовании и назначении?
Какие основные отличия существуют между абстрактным и конкретным классами в объектно-ориентированном программировании?
Объясните концепцию делегатов в языке C# и их основное назначение.
Что помогало вам сохранять мотивацию при создании качественного продукта в вашей предыдущей компании?
Могли бы вы объяснить, что представляет собой анализ дампа памяти и для чего он используется?
Каким образом можно создать класс, который гарантирует существование только одного экземпляра и предоставляет глобальную точку доступа к нему?
Есть ли у вас опыт настройки и запуска серверных приложений или инфраструктуры?
Объясните концепцию виртуальных методов в языке C# и их роль в реализации полиморфизма.
Что отличает протокол HTTPS от HTTP и почему это важно для безопасности?
В каком месте следует сохранять данные о первом этапе при создании временного кода для подтверждения через SMS?
Как осуществляется продолжение выполнения функции после приостановки из-за асинхронной операции?
Какой у вас опыт в области тестирования и оптимизации систем под высоким трафиком?
Работали ли вы с базами данных в памяти при написании тестов?
Каким образом можно применить модульное тестирование для проверки интерфейса Consumer?